How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Masten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Masten Park Studio Apartments | $1,479 | $358 | $2,648 |
| Masten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,508 | $376 | $5,368 |
Masten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,931 | $445 | $3,102 |
| Masten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,617 | $849 | $3,778 |
| Masten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,633 | $646 | $3,496 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Masten Park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Masten Park with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Masten Park is at Delaware Court Apartments listed at $1,175.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Masten Park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Masten Park is $1,931.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Masten Park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Masten Park is a 1,800 square feet unit starting from $3,475 at EB Green Residence.
What is the average size for Masten Park 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Masten Park is currently 1,310 sq ft.
